Brain Injury Bites is a podcast based around the experiences of sustaining a brain injury and provides helpful hints and tips for injured people, their friends and family. The show is hosted by Brooke Trotter and Ashwini Kamath. Brooke was a pedestrian involved in a road traffic collision in May 2007, which left him with a severe traumatic brain injury. Ashwini is a Trustee and Chair for Headway Warrington and a Senior Associate Solicitor with over ten years of experience supporting families after brain injury.

26. An interview with Sian Riley: Dietician (Part 1)
In this episode of Brain Injury Bites, Ashwani and Brooke are joined by Sian Riley from Red Pepper Nutrition. Sian is a dietician specialising in rehabilitation with a focus on brain injury. They discuss the importance of nutrition in the rehabilitation journey, the impact of smell and taste loss after brain injury, and strategies to improve the eating experience.
